ENTERTAINMENTS.

EVERYBODY'S. ALICE JOYCE IN "AN ALABASTER , BOX." Alice Joyce was see in a Greater Vitagraph triumph, "An Alabastpr Box," at Evcrybody'3 last night. The story tells of Lydia Bolton, who is only a child when financial difficulties overtake her father. His friends give him 110 support, and he goes to prison, an embezzler, cursed by everyone. Years after, when Lydia has grown to womanhood, she come 3 back, her identity hidden in the name of Lydia Orr, and from then on the story develops in an exceptionally interesting manner. The supports includa another of those clover and remarkably interesting cartoon pictures, "Bairnsfather's War Cartoons." The same programme will be repeated for the last time to-night. THE EMPPIRE. MABEL TALIAFERRO IX "THE JURY OF FATE." AND THE ■ "GOT AT PENDLETON ROUND-UP." Five acts of emotional story make up "The Jury of Fate." a startling drama that is being unfolded as the new feature at the Empire. ''The Jury of l'atc," i? another release from the Metro studios, and the interest of the tale that is told is much enhanced by the happy work of Mebal Taliaferro, who is the star. The story is neatly set, too, and some of Ihe incidental scenes are true gems of artistic photography. The second best of the new films is "Pendleton Round-up," a series of photographs of Western cowboys at work- The latest American Gazette brings top.cal interest to the entertainment, which sets before patrons a. widely-varied ran'je of interests. The new bill also includes tin* sixth episode of the exciting circus serial "Peg 0' the Ring '' The full programme will be repeated to-night.

MATINEE TO-MORROW. . A brilliant matinee programme has been arranged for the kiddies to-morrow when the principal picture will lie "The Pendleton Round-up," the sixth episode of "Peg 0' the Ring.'' a Mack Sehnett comedy "Those College Girls," an American Topical Gazette and another Keystone comedy.
